  3. 17 hours ago · Symptoms include fever, headache, nausea, vomiting, lack of appetite, muscle pain, abdominal pain (may mimic appendicitis), conjunctival injection (red eyes), rash, cough, sore throat, and diarrhea. If infection with Rocky Mountain Spotted fever is suspected, treatment should never be delayed and should start within the first five days.
